Authentic Junior’s cheesecake flavors of MRE Lite come in a larger 30 serving tub at Vitamin Shoppe

Redcon1 Juniors Collaborations In 30 Serving Tub At Vitamin Shoppe

Redcon1’s recent flavor collaborations with the legendary restaurant chain Junior’s and its selection of delicious cheesecakes aren’t only available directly through its online store, nor do they come in just smaller-than-usual tub sizes. On their debut, the two-time Brand Of The Year winner had its Junior’s Raspberry Swirl Cheesecake and Peanut Butter Chocolate Cheesecake flavors of MRE Lite available in 20 serving tubs over at redcon1.com, ten servings less than the supplement’s usual size.

At the moment, those 20 serving tubs are all Redcon1 has for its Junior’s Raspberry Swirl Cheesecake and Peanut Butter Chocolate Cheesecake MRE Lites on its website, although if you head over to The Vitamin Shoppe, that’s not the case. Through the retailer, you’ll find both of those authentic flavors, inspired by classic Junior’s cheesecakes, in the usual MRE Lite tub size of 30 servings, and at the moment, they’re drastically discounted down from $44.99 to a more competitive $33.74 a piece.

At $44.99, the 30-serving tubs of Redcon1’s Junior’s collaborations are not as cost-effective as the 20 servings at $24.99 on redcon1.com.
